Reforms to boost farmers’ income, former BJP chief

Ludhiana, December 17

Coming in support of farm laws, former Punjab BJP president Rajinder Bhandari said the Central Government is committed to address the apprehensions of farmers on agri laws and will always welcome dialogue with farmers. He said the recent meetings and parleys between the agitating farmer groups and senior ministers is a step towards addressing all fears and misconceptions.

Bhandari added the Central government of BJP has taken all the interests and long-standing economic duress of the agrarian sector of the nation while coming out with these revolutionary laws, which will uplift the stagnant income of the farming community.

He added the government was open to dialogue and would listen patiently to all the apprehensions of the farmers and address their issues. — TNS
